Trayvon Martin protesters in Washington, D.C. gathered outside the Department of Justice on Friday, demanding equality and a color-blind justice system.

The protest took place six days after George Zimmerman was acquitted of second-degree murder and manslaughter. Protesters believed that the trial unfairly plotted Martin’s race against him. They championed for a more post-racial society.

The group stressed the importance of individual activism, stressing that anyone can and should take action. A few protesters wore hooded sweatshirts, held Skittles and bore signs reading, “I AM TRAYVON MARTIN.”

“Now here’s a guy, a vigilante, that can shoot a young un-armed black kid in cold blood and the system says he doesn’t do anything wrong,” one protester said to the small crowd. “But this is the system we live in, this is our Department of Justice, not Injustice. But whose justice is it?”

More protests marches and demonstrations will be held in the nation’s capital throughout the weekend as the community expresses their discontent with their peer-run justice system.

“I think that it’s important to recognize that the a community is looking at this through the eyes of a set of experiences a history and doesn’t go away,” President Barack Obama said in a press briefing on Friday.
